Caprese Skewers Pesto Drizzle

This dish features cherry tomatoes, mini mozzarella balls, and fresh basil threaded onto skewers for easy serving. A zesty homemade pesto, made from basil, pine nuts, garlic, Parmesan, and olive oil, is drizzled on top to elevate the fresh flavors. Ideal for quick assembly, these skewers bring a refreshing, colorful touch to any summer event. Variations include substituting nuts or adding balsamic vinegar for extra depth.

Ingredients

  • Skewers
    • 12 cherry tomatoes
    • 12 mini mozzarella balls (bocconcini)
    • 12 fresh basil leaves
    • 12 small wooden or bamboo skewers
  • Pesto Drizzle
    • 1/2 cup fresh basil leaves, packed
    • 2 tablespoons pine nuts
    • 1 small garlic clove
    •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
    • 1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
    •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ste

Instructions

1. Thread skewers
Thread one cherry tomato, one mozzarella ball, and one basil leaf onto each skewer. Arrange the skewers on a serving platter.
2. Make the pesto
In a food processor, combine basil leaves, pine nuts, garlic, and Parmesan. Pulse until finely chopped.
3. Blend pesto
With the processor running, slowly drizzle in the olive oil until the pesto is smooth.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
4. Drizzle pesto
Drizzle the pesto over the assembled skewers just before serving.

Assemble the skewers up to four hours ahead and keep them refrigerated to save time. Add the pesto drizzle only just before serving to maintain the freshness and texture of the ingredients.

For a nut-free pesto, substitute sunflower seeds for the pine nuts. To deepen the flavor, add a drizzle of aged balsamic vinegar right before serving for a touch of sweetness and acidity.

Recipe FAQs

Can I prepare the skewers in advance?

Yes, you can assemble the skewers up to 4 hours ahead and refrigerate them. Add the pesto drizzle just before serving for the freshest taste.

How can I make a nut-free version of the pesto?

Replace pine nuts with sunflower seeds in the pesto to keep it nut-free while maintaining a rich texture and flavor.

What is the best way to thread the ingredients on the skewers?

Thread one cherry tomato, one mini mozzarella ball, and one fresh basil leaf per skewer for a balanced bite of flavors.

Can I add extra seasoning or flavor?

Yes, a drizzle of aged balsamic vinegar enhances the flavor and adds a subtle tang when served.

What tools are recommended for making the pesto?

A food processor or blender works best to combine basil, pine nuts, garlic, Parmesan, and olive oil into a smooth pesto drizzle.
